TOPEKA, Kan, - The Newman men's basketball team looks to rebound from its first loss of the 2011-12 season, when they travel to Topeka to take on the Washburn University Ichabods. Tip-off is slated for 1 p.m., at Lee Arena, and the game will be broadcast live in Topeka on WIBW 580 AM.
Meet the Jets...
Newman's fast start wouldn't be possible without a complete team effort. The Jets are out-scoring their opposition by nearly 11 points a game, holding opponents to just over 58 points per contest. Newman is holding opponents to a 38 percent field goal percentage, and locking down the perimeter holding them to 20 percent shooting from behind the arc.
Three Jets are averaging double figures in points, highlighted by Eric Saunders 13 point-per-game average. Chuck Coley joins Saunders in double figures, averaging 10.5 points per game. Newman is averaging 14.8 assists per outing, led by Eric Saunders' 4.5 assists per contest. Chuck Coley is the team's leader in rebounds, averaging seven per outing.
Last Time Out...
Fort Hays State put a blemish on Newman's perfect season, handing them their first loss of the year, 75-65. The Jets battled back after trailing by as many as 18 points during the first half. Newman cut the lead down to six after a Ryan McCarthy three-pointer with 4:22 left in regulation. Ultimately, fouls would be to costly as the Jets put FHSU on the free-throw stripe 12 times during the second half. Newman's full-court press proved valuable as they forced 24 turnovers during the game. Chuck Coley led all scorers with 18 points, while Eric Saunders chipped in with 17 points for the night.
Scouting Washburn...
Washburn is coming off of a 97-72 victory over Peru State on November 22. Will McNeill paced the Ichabods in scoring with 21 points, and Bobby Chipman was strong on the boards with eight rebounds on the night. The Ichabods are led by Will McNeill who is averaging 20 points per game, and is also leading the team in rebounds, averaging 6.4 rebounds per contest. Martin Mitchell joins McNeill in double-figures, averaging 12points per game. Bobby Chipman is second on the squad in rebounds, averaging 6.2 rebounds per contest.
Renewing a Rivalry... Friday's meeting marks the first time since the 2005-06 season that Newman has played Washburn. The Ichabods own a 17-5 record all-time against the Jets. The last time Newman defeated Washburn was during the 1980-81 season, when the Jets defeated the Ichabods 79-72 in Topeka. Since then, Washburn has reeled off 14 straight victories over Newman.
